    all who are hatching quail

    I have found that only the waterers work well with quail chicks until they are 5-7 days old because of their size and weakness. I raise ~1000 bobwhites a year and haven't had very good luck with anything else. I am using GQF brooders so I can hang the water in troughs outside once they are big...

    all who are hatching quail

    I usually average about 80-85% hatch rate and then lose another 5-10% during the first week. I have about 400 bobs that are 5 weeks old after setting 500 eggs. My second hatch is just 3 weeks old and still have about 425 alive. I have found humidity to be important the last 2-4 days before they...

    all who are hatching quail

    From all the research I can find the optimum incubation h umidityfor bobwhite quail is 50-60% to give enough volume loss to allow chick grow without dehydrating them. The humidity for the last 3-5 days needs to be ~70-75% to soften the shell for hatching. I use a GQF cabinet incubator and...
